Understanding Muscle Building
Muscle building, or bulking, focuses on increasing muscle mass and strength through a combination of resistance training and proper nutrition. Here are some key elements:
- Caloric Surplus: To build muscle, you need to consume more calories than you burn. This provides the energy necessary for growth.
- Protein Intake: A high-protein diet is crucial as protein is the building block of muscle.
- Progressive Overload: Increasing weights or resistance over time is vital for continual muscle growth.
Understanding Fat Reduction
On the other hand, fat reduction, commonly referred to as cutting, aims at losing body fat while maintaining lean muscle mass. Key strategies include:
- Caloric Deficit: You must consume fewer calories than your body needs in order to lose weight.
- Nutrient Timing: Eating strategically, particularly around workouts, can optimize fat loss and muscle preservation.
- Cardiovascular Exercise: Incorporating cardio can help increase calorie burn and aid in fat loss.
Choosing the Right Cycle for You
The decision between muscle building and fat reduction depends on several factors:
- Your Current Physique: If you’re starting from a lean standpoint, you may want to focus on building muscle first.
- Your Goals: Determine what’s more important to you at this moment: more mass or less fat?
- Your Experience Level: Beginners might benefit from focusing on muscle building to improve foundational strength and fitness.
- Your Health Condition: Always consult with a healthcare provider before starting any new fitness or diet regimen.
